Web22 de mar. de 2024 · It’s the hottest planet in our solar system, even though Mercury is closer to the Sun. Surface temperatures on Venus are about 900 degrees Fahrenheit (475 degrees Celsius) – hot enough to melt lead. The surface is a rusty color and it’s peppered with intensely crunched mountains and thousands of large volcanoes. WebThe highest point on Venus, the mountain Maxwell Montes is located on Ishtar Terra. The second continent, Aphrodite Terra, is located along the equator and is about the size of South America. WebHowever, I couldn't find the values for the lowest point. All I could find is that it's somewhere in Diana chasma , 1.8 km below mean terrain height. Since Venus' atmosphere is so dense, it's expected that, at lowest elevations, even small changes in height will produce dramatic changes in pressure since scale height of Venus is 15.9 km.

This Magellan full-resolution image shows Maxwell Montes, and is centered at 65 degrees north latitude and 6 degrees east longitude. Maxwell is the highest mountain on Venus, rising almost 11 kilometers (6.8 miles) above mean planetary radius.
